Merge branch 'yn/worktree-ambiguous-remote-advice' into jch

'git worktree add' did not prevent DWIM behavior when '-b' or '-B' was
specified, which has been corrected.

* yn/worktree-ambiguous-remote-advice:
  worktree add: treat multiple matches with --guess-remote as an error
  worktree add: improve message for ambiguous remote branch name
  checkout: improve message for ambiguous remote branch name
  checkout: extract function to display advice for ambiguous remotes
